Secure both pedestal and bench style grinders securely to the floor or work bench to prevent movement during usage. Store grinding wheels carefully on racks in dry places, and visually inspect them for warping, chips, cracks or other damage before installation. Discard used wheels once they are approximately 2/3 worn.

Machine Shop Inspection Form Shop Supervisor: EID: Department: Date: Inspector(s): Building/Room #: Y N N/A Y N N/A Y N N/A Y N N/A 1. Machine in service 2. Tongue guard less than 1/4 inch 3. Tool/work rest less than 1/8 inch 4. Secured to floor or bench top 5. Electrical cord in good working condition 6. Antirestart estop button present ...

Are dust collectors and powered exhausts provided on grinders used in operations that produce large amounts of dust? 133(a)(1) Are goggles or face shields always worn when grinding? 212(b) Are bench and pedestal grinders permanently mounted? 304(f)(4) Is each electrically operated grinder effectively grounded? 305(g)(1)(iii)(A)
